SenpaiSeiji wrote:

Anyone encounter a memory card problem? It cant read my sandisk A1 512gb mem card after I updated my switch but my older 128gb mem card works fine.

You likely have to reformat that 512gb card. If you have a pc, you can save the card's Nintendo folder to PC so you reformat the card, then copy the Nintendo folder back onto the card. That way, you don't have to re-download games back onto it.

(Or, your card died. But I think that's less likely.)

jejesh26

hi guys,

my bother and I are facing up same issue with two different docks and switch. When docked, no TV signal, since the upgrade to 13.2.0.
Have tried both docks, mixed the power supply, ... same issue.
Have unplugged everything several time with no luck.
Docks are "old", with no ethernet port to reset them.
Some guys said they fixed the issue but how ? We want to avoid a hard reset as mentioned by pressing the power button at least 12s.. What are the other solutions rather than waiting for a fix by nintendo ?

SKTTR

@jejesh26

You don't lose anything by a hard reset. Just save your last game that might be still running in standby and you'll be good.

You don't need to change docks or power supplies. You just need to power off the Switch, that's all.
